After logging into Linux machine I need to enter a value so that environment will be setup

I am trying to login to my Linux machine. It usually asks for username, password and then I need to enter a value like DEV, TEST or UAT. based on this last input, environment variables are being set. When I am using winscp, authentication is being successful but server is waiting for last input (DEV, TEST or UAT). Since I do not have any option to enter last input, I am getting timeout error. is there any option in winscp to resolve this issue? Please let me know. Thank you

Re: After logging into Linux machine I need to enter a value so that environment will be setup

What protocol? Please attach a full session log file showing the problem (using the latest version of WinSCP).

To generate the session log file, enable logging, log in to your server and do the operation and only the operation that causes the error. Submit the log with your post as an attachment. Note that passwords and passphrases not stored in the log. You may want to remove other data you consider sensitive though, such as host names, IP addresses, account names or file names (unless they are relevant to the problem). If you do not want to post the log publicly, you can mark the attachment as private.
